This is a followup to /firstuserhere/experimental-firstuserheres-guessin

Here's how this works:

  • Anyone can submit a free response option in the form of a guess that they have about @firstuserhere . It can be about anything - guesses about my music taste, my research interests, my sleep habits, etc.

  • Try to guess something that's not already known about me.

  • I can resolve options N/A if I don't want to answer them.

  • Otherwise, I'll resolve to YES if the guess was right, NO if the guess was wrong, and PROB if it was partly right and partly wrong.

  • Between the option being submitted and me actually seeing and resolving it, you (and other traders) can spend mana to try to make a profit. If you're confident in a guess, buy YES - if you think someone has it wrong, buy NO. For obvious reasons, I won't bet on the options before resolving then. I'll check once per day(after loans refresh) so there's time to bet on the options.

  • This continues indefinitely, because the market doesn't close when I resolve an individual option.
